Understanding Foot Drop & Plantar Fasciitis
What is Foot Drop?
Foot drop, also known as drop foot, is a condition characterized by difficulty lifting the front part of the foot due to weakness or paralysis of the muscles involved. This may result from nerve damage, muscle disorders, or spinal cord injuries. Foot drop can cause significant discomfort and mobility issues, affecting daily activities such as walking and standing.
What is Plantar Fasciitis?
Plantar fasciitis is a common foot condition caused by inflammation of the plantar fascia, a thick band of tissue running along the bottom of the foot. This condition often leads to heel pain and discomfort, particularly when taking the first steps after resting or engaging in physical activity. It is essential to address plantar fasciitis early on to avoid further complications and improve quality of life.
